Queering the Air is a radical weekly radio show on 3CR that amplifies the voices, cultures, and struggles of LGBTQIA+ communities - especially those often excluded from mainstream media. Grounded in queer, anti-racist, feminist, and anti-capitalist perspectives, the show features interviews, music, discussions, and news with a focus on justice, solidarity, and community care. Produced collectively, Queering the Air connects queer liberation to broader movements like prison abolition, migrant justice, and disability rights.
